Jonathan David makes history with a hat-trick at the World Cup for the Canadian national team.

The world of football was left in shock by the historic performance of Jonathan David, the Juventus forward, who became the first Canadian player to score a hat-trick in a World Cup. However, it was not all celebrations for Canada: Ismael Koné, a midfielder for Sassuolo, was stretchered off after suffering a serious leg fracture, plunging the team and fans into a mix of euphoria and concern.

On the night of June 18, 2026, Canadian fans will remember a resounding 6-0 victory against Qatar in the second round of Group B of the World Cup, held at BC Place in Vancouver. Jonathan David shone brightly, scoring three of the team’s six goals, thus becoming the first Canadian to achieve such a feat on the biggest stage of world football. However, the excitement was abruptly interrupted early in the second half when Ismael Koné fell to the ground, visibly in pain, after a tough challenge from Assim Madibo, at a time when Canada was leading 3-0. The yellow card initially shown to Madibo was quickly upgraded to a red after VAR review, leaving Qatar with ten players.

This victory not only strengthens Canada’s bid for a historic presence in the knockout stage but also places Jonathan David at the top of the tournament’s scoring list, raising expectations around the young Juventus forward. On the other hand, the injury to Koné is a heavy blow for the team, which loses one of its main midfield references. The absence of the Sassuolo midfielder presents an additional challenge for coach Jesse Marsch, who will need to find alternatives to maintain the team’s rhythm and creativity in the upcoming matches.

In the aftermath of the match, Jesse Marsch did not hide his sadness over Koné’s injury, but he emphasized the importance and character of the player: “Ismael is a fantastic kid – he’s so imperfect, but that’s why we love him. He can do things that no one else can, and in the next moment, he loses his concentration. He is the mirror of our team; it’s a huge loss for all of us. He will recover; we will give him the best doctors and bring him back, but that kid is essential for our future and for everything we are building,” the Canadian coach said, visibly emotional, to The Sun after the match.

Both Jonathan David and Ismael Koné arrive at the World Cup after a competitive debut season in Italy. David scored eight goals in 46 matches for Juventus, while Koné netted six goals in 36 appearances for Sassuolo. David’s incredible performance at the World Cup is being closely monitored by several European clubs, although Italian media report that Juventus is willing to listen to offers for the forward during the upcoming transfer window. However, according to Gazzetta, Jonathan David intends to stay in Turin and fight for a starting position in the 2026/27 season, showing ambition and loyalty to the club where he seeks to establish himself as an offensive reference.

On a competitive level, Canada now positions itself as one of the most dangerous outsiders in the World Cup, driven by the confidence of a devastating attack, but it will have to overcome the adversity of losing one of its key players in midfield. The upcoming matches will serve to assess the team’s tactical response capacity, as well as their emotional resilience in the face of such a significant loss. For Jonathan David, this hat-trick may just be the beginning of a journey that propels him to global stardom and, eventually, to a lucrative transfer if he maintains this level of performance. The World Cup continues to surprise, and for Canada, tonight in Vancouver will forever be marked by a mix of glory and tragedy – the perfect ingredients for a truly unforgettable World Championship.
